Sphenarina
Taxonomy
Sphenarina was named by Cooper (1959) [Sepkoski's age data: T Plio Sepkoski's reference number: 1].
It was assigned to Hispanirhynchiidae by Cooper (1959); to Rhynchonellida by Sepkoski (2002); and to Hispanirhynchiinae by Williams et al. (2002).
